Happy Friday!! We're back again with another First Show Friday! This week we had the pleasure of talking to the infamous Jason Burke!

“My introduction to the music scene was in high school (1998-2001). It was amazing seeing people like Alicia Penney sing on a trip to Lake Wind Studios (i think?), and Guilt Trip playing in the little theater. I didn't know that being in a band was even an option up until this point.”

“After a few years of jamming with different people I finally joined my first band, Dethridge, with Kyle Tutty, Marc Langille and Corey Macleod. Dethridge had already played some shows in the scene, and I ended up joining them after they parted ways with one of their guitar players. I played my first show with them at the South End Community Centre in January 2004. I remember Undertone, Violent Theory, erosion, Apathy, and maybe Spasmodic being on the bill. I was extremely nervous. We were set to be the last band of the night, and as things started running late, we were told we'd have to cut our set to 5 songs. 10 minutes later we were told it would be 3 songs. Right before we were about to play we were told we only had enough time for 2 songs. We picked the 2 songs we wanted to play and ripped into the first one. Then we were told to cut it off. My first set was 3 minutes long, and we had an audience of 7 people. Not the best start to being in a band. But after that song, Matt Canova (who i later got to be in a couple great bands with) yelled out “that was fucking glorious!” and the feeling of having someone in a crowd react to your music like that completely overshadowed the disappointment with the length of the set, or the size of the crowd”

Jason not only plays a big role in the music scene through his music, but he has always been a huge supporter of all things local.

“I've been lucky to be in a whole slew of bands over the last 20ish years. Dethridge, Ground Zero. Athymia, Centralia, Stygian Sky, Mortality Work, Abattoir, The Novemberists (Decemberists tribute) Tamarack, The Shithawks, Cap Gun, Super Mario Burkes, Pen Cap Chew (Nirvana tribute), The Yarnells, Low Rentals, Riff Raff (classic rock cover band), and was absolutely honored to be asked to join Yellow. Oh, and playing with Alicia Penney currently untitled solo band!”

“Ive been able to open for some awesome bands (Bucket Truck, Fuck The Facts, Anvil, Green Jelly, The Brains, Cancer Bats). Ive been able to jam with some of the best musicians, and become close friends with some of the best people. All because I decided to pick up a guitar when I was 13 years old!”
